A THEROPOD DINOSAUR BONE FROM THE LATE CRETACEOUS MOLECAP GREENSAND, WESTERN AUSTRALIA
Part 2 143 143 LONG, JOHN A. Abstract - A proximal pedal phalanx from a theropod dinosaur is recorded from the Late Cretaceous Molecap Greensand, at Gingin, Western Australia. It is only the second record of a Late Cretaceus dinosaur from Australia, and the first dinosaur bone recovered from the Perth ...
